Phone number ☎️ 09037080400 👆 is reported as a premium rate number often linked to HMRC enquiries but users frequently complain about exorbitant call costs, with charges sometimes exceeding £80 for under half an hour. Callers often feel misled, with long hold times and unclear call handlers, leading to frustration over expensive, unexpected bills. There are multiple reports of unrecognised charges appearing on phone bills, some suspected scams, and difficulty in getting refunds. Many mention their providers offering little support. Users advise caution as the number is tied to costly calls that can put vulnerable people, including pensioners, under financial strain. Several urge others to avoid calling and to report suspicious activity to providers.

Call Charges

If you want to return a call to ☎️ 09037080400 👆, it will cost you between between £1.00 to £3.60 per minute on landline and between between £1.00 to £3.60 per minute on mobile. Additionally, there might be a connection charge between between £0.05 to £6.00. Calls to this number might also result in access charges between £0.08 to £0.67 per minute.

About 09 Numbers

These premium rate numbers are often used for different kinds of services like TV voting, horoscopes, contests, chat lines, adult services, recorded information, and professional consultation. If you desire, you can prevent these numbers from being dialed from your phone, just like you can block other numbers. Additionally, such numbers are regulated by the Phone-paid Services Authority.
